Tiny Pecan Pies

    | 1. Preheat oven to 325*F. | 2. Mix cream cheese and butter together. | 3. Stir in flour. | 4. Chill dough for 1 hour. | 5. Shape dough into 24 balls and place in 24 muffin tins. | 6. Press dough into regular muffin tins, working it up the sides and into the bottom. | 7. *Note: Mini muffin tins can be used but you may need to reduce the cooking time. | 8. Sprinkle 1/2 of the pecans into the bottom of the dough lined muffin cups. | 9. Beat together egg, 1 Tablespoon of butter, brown sugar, salt and vanilla until smooth. | 10. Spoon filing over the pecans in the muffin cups. | 11. Top with remaining pecans. | 12. Bake at 325*F. for 25 minutes or until set. | 13. Cool completely before removing from muffin tins. | 14. Make about 24 tiny pecan pies. | 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
